C1649: C1649: Electronic Stability Control (ESC) Malfunction

📖 What Does C1649 Mean on 2020 Chevrolet SILVERADO 1500 PICKUP?
Symptoms
- • Vibration
- • loss of traction
- • pulling to one side
- • reduced acceleration
- • and/or the ESC warning light on the dashboard
Common Causes
- • Faulty ESC module
- • faulty wheel speed sensors
- • faulty yaw rate sensor
- • faulty lateral acceleration sensor
- • or a faulty steering angle sensor
How to Fix C1649 on 2020 Chevrolet SILVERADO 1500 PICKUP
1. Clear any trouble codes with a scan tool. 2. Check and replace any faulty sensors. 3. Update the ESC module's software if necessary. 4. Check and repair any wiring issues.
